Written question asked by David Reed (Conservative) on Monday, 2 December 2024, in the House of Commons. It was due for an answer on Wednesday, 4 December 2024. It was answered by Luke Pollard (Labour) on Monday, 9 December 2024 on behalf of the Ministry of Defence.


HMS Prince of Wales and HMS Queen Elizabeth

Question

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ence, with reference to his oral evidence of 21 November 2024 to the Defence Select Committee, HC 345, what steps he is taking to ensure the planned deployments of (a) HMS Queen Elizabeth and (b) HMS Prince of Wales take place as scheduled in 2025.

Answer

The Ministry of Defence remains committed to deploying HMS Prince of Wales as part of the Carrier Strike Group deployment to the Indo-Pacific in 2025. It would be inappropriate to discuss other planned deployments as to do so could compromise operational security.
